Abstract
⺠Mola mola in the NW Atlantic spent N80% of time in the top 200 m of the water column and dove to depths > 800 m. ⺠Ocean sunfish in the NW Atlantic shifted their diving behavior from shallow and surface oriented in the summer to deeper diving and less surface time in the winter. ⺠Ocean sunfish in the Gulf Stream avoided surface waters and dove to depths of 400-800 m. ⺠M. mola exhibited a diel pattern in diving behavior.
